1. Planning
The first step involves detailed planning and selecting the site for the container installation. This includes assessing the terrain, transportation access, and obtaining necessary permits. The site must be prepared by leveling the ground and ensuring stable foundations that can support the weight and load of the modular units.
2. Logistics
Once the site is ready, the modules are transported to the location. IteraSpace Modular Solutions coordinates the safe transportation of the units using specialized trucks and cranes. It is important to coordinate with local authorities regarding traffic closures or special permits required for the transport.
3. Inspection of prepared build site
At the prepared location, the foundations for the units are laid, which can be concrete or steel depending on the requirements and size of the module. Additionally, key utilities like water, electricity, sewage, and HVAC systems are installed. It is crucial to ensure that all connections are correctly positioned to link up with the units.
4. Placement and Assembly of the modules
Using cranes, the units are carefully placed on the prepared foundations. The units can be set side by side or stacked in multiple levels. During placement, it is essential to ensure that all modules are aligned properly, as the overall stability of the structure depends on this precision.
5. Connection and Insulation
Once the units are in place, they are connected and sealed. This involves securing the modules to each other and installing insulation materials to ensure energy efficiency and protection from weather conditions. Additionally, safety systems like fire protection and any necessary reinforcements are installed.
6. Final Touches and Handover
Finally, finishing touches are applied, including the installation of interior fittings, completion of exterior facades, windows, doors, and conducting final inspections of utilities (electricity, water, heating). Once all technical inspections are completed and the structure meets the required standards, the project is handed over to the client.
